Just got my Rx refilled and the pills looked different from my last fill, so researched to ensure it was the right pill. I have the Lupin simvastatin 20's as well. It's oval in shape, somewhat smaller, clay in color, with LL and C03 impressions. See http://www.lupinpharmaceuticals.com/sim6.htm
